1. Artificial Intelligence as a Co-author

AI is no longer science fiction, but part of the daily lives of creators. Today, tools such as ChatGPT, Jasper, or Writesonic already help generate ideas, structure articles and even create complete marketing campaigns.

But the key point is: AI doesn't replace human creativity, it amplifies it.

Practical examples

  • Video scriptsInstead of starting from scratch, you can ask the AI for an initial structure and then customize it with your voice and experience.
  • Smart SEOtools such as SurferSEO or Semrush already use AI to suggest keywords, titles and even optimize readability.
  • Fast designplatforms such as Canva e Figma have incorporated AI to generate layouts, images and even presentations in seconds.

2. Realistic Videos: Between Innovation and Ethics

Hyper-realistic videos, also known as positive deepfakes or short videosare gaining ground. With AI, it's possible to create digital avatars that speak in several languages, dub content automatically or even recreate scenarios without the need for expensive studios.

Positive applications

  • Educationteachers can create lessons in different languages without having to re-record.
  • Accessibilityautomatic subtitles and real-time translation make content more inclusive.
  • Marketingbrands already use digital avatars for personalized campaigns.

The ethical challenge

The same resource that can educate can also manipulate. The proliferation of fake videos raises serious questions about ethics, privacy and trust. Therefore, the future of content creation will require not only creativity, but also digital responsibility.

3. Algorithms: The New Editor-in-Chief

If before the public decided what they read or saw, today it is the recommendation algorithms. They analyze behavior, preferences and interactions to deliver "tailor-made" content.

How they work

  • TikTok: prioritizes retention and rapid interaction.
  • YouTube: values viewing time and consistency.
  • InstagramThe most important thing is that it combines relevance, proximity and engagement.

Practical strategy

  • Produce content that answer real questions of the public.
  • Use optimized titles and descriptions for SEO.
  • Bet on short, engaging formats (Reels, Shorts, Carousels).

4. The Future of Content Creation

Looking ahead to the next few years, some trends are already emerging:

  • Extreme customizationEach user will see content tailored to their profile.
  • Human + AI integration: breeders who know how to use AI as a partner will have a competitive advantage.
  • Authenticity as a differentiatorIn a sea of automated content, those who maintain their own identity will stand out.
  • Multimodal contenttext, audio, video and interactivity fused into a single experience.

5. How Creators Can Prepare

  1. Embracing AI without losing your own voice Use technology to speed up processes, but maintain authenticity.
  2. Investing in digital literacy Understanding how algorithms work is just as important as mastering writing techniques.
  3. Explore new formats Test podcasts, newsletters, short videos and even augmented reality experiences.
  4. Building community More than followers, you need to create lasting relationships.

 

The future of content creation will not just be dominated by machines, but by people who know how to create content. using technology as an ally. AI, realistic videos and algorithms are powerful tools, but what really connects is the the story we tell.
